Andrew Bogott has uploaded a new change for review.

  https://gerrit.wikimedia.org/r/307994

Change subject: Rename the labs instance setting labs_puppet_master.
......................................................................

Rename the labs instance setting labs_puppet_master.

We were using the same labs_puppet_master variable for
two unrelated purposes.  Now the one that's used on labs
to determine whether or not to set root passwords is named
labs_global_puppet_master.  Hopefully people won't be
tempted to override this.

Change-Id: If47fb903313a295f163385177d8d647ad49d3304
---
M hieradata/labs.yaml
M modules/base/manifests/labs.pp
2 files changed, 2 insertions(+), 2 deletions(-)


  git pull ssh://gerrit.wikimedia.org:29418/operations/puppet 
refs/changes/94/307994/1

diff --git a/hieradata/labs.yaml b/hieradata/labs.yaml
index c86a0a2..cf494f1 100644
--- a/hieradata/labs.yaml
+++ b/hieradata/labs.yaml
@@ -332,4 +332,4 @@
           ipv4: 10.196.48.0/24
           ipv6: 2620:0:860:204::/64
 
-labs_puppet_master: &labspuppetmaster "labs-puppetmaster-eqiad.wikimedia.org"
+labs_global_puppet_master: &labspuppetmaster 
"labs-puppetmaster-eqiad.wikimedia.org"
diff --git a/modules/base/manifests/labs.pp b/modules/base/manifests/labs.pp
index 54e44c2..5a1bcb6 100644
--- a/modules/base/manifests/labs.pp
+++ b/modules/base/manifests/labs.pp
@@ -54,7 +54,7 @@
     #  puppetmaster.  Self- and locally-hosted instances are on their own,
     #  but most likely already registered a password during their initial
     #  setup.
-    if $::puppetmastername == hiera('labs_puppet_master') {
+    if $::puppetmastername == hiera('labs_global_puppet_master') {
         # Create a root password and store it on the puppetmaster
         user { 'root':
             password => regsubst(

-- 
To view, visit https://gerrit.wikimedia.org/r/307994
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: newchange
Gerrit-Change-Id: If47fb903313a295f163385177d8d647ad49d3304
Gerrit-PatchSet: 1
Gerrit-Project: operations/puppet
Gerrit-Branch: production
Gerrit-Owner: Andrew Bogott <[email protected]>

_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to